Filling in the missing part of a sequence could be a winner, i.e. 3 6 9 15.

The idea suggested by Mel would be easily operated, whereby we can read 
something like ACD58G, and are then asked to enter the third and fifth 
characters.

Its obvious that solutions are out there, but graphical verification is the 
darling of the security conscious at the moment, God knows what it'll take 
to change their minds on this one!

It is good though to see Auntie Beeb looking into alternatives.
